What is the primary function of a capacitor?

Explanation:
A capacitor’s main role is to store electrical energy temporarily. It does this by creating an electric field between two conductors separated by a dielectric. This lets the capacitor supply or absorb short bursts of current, help smooth voltage levels, and filter signals in a circuit. It’s not meant for permanent energy storage—the energy can be delivered quickly when needed, but it isn’t stored for long periods like a battery. Converting AC to DC requires rectifiers, and regulating current is handled by other components or regulators; a capacitor by itself doesn’t perform those functions.
